Grand Valley State University swept the competition in the Michigan Dodgeball Cup, racking up 31 total points against other teams from around the state. Despite some close points, GVSU was able to go unscathed with no points scored against them. This marks the fourth straight year that GVSU has won the Michigan Dodgeball Cup.


Grand Valley shut Central Michigan out, 12-0, on October 12 in GVSU's first home match in nearly a year. Despite forcing GVSU down to less than 5 players early in the match, Central Michigan could not manage to win the point. GVSU's JV team also won 5-1, demonstrating their potential as a force to be reckoned with this season.


In the 2008/2009 season's first match, Grand Valley beat Saginaw Valley 5-0 (5-1 JV) at SVSU, edging out some close points against a competitive Saginaw Valley team.

GVSU's Varsity team won the 2008 NCDA National Championship, held in Ohio State over April 12-13. After shutting out DePaul and Bowling Green, GVSU nearly lost to Delta College, edging out a win (3-2) in overtime. GVSU went on to shut out Wisconsin-Platteville and Saginaw Valley and beat Ohio State 9-1 in the final match.
